Sauternes

Classic 4 dishes

Dessert · Full · Sweet

Bordeaux's legendary sweet white — Semillon and Sauvignon Blanc hit by noble rot, then patiently fermented. Honey, apricot, candied citrus, and a finish that lasts a small eternity. Pair with foie gras, blue cheese, or a fruit tart.
